Decision:
Cabinet:
-
Approvedthe draft Rainham and Beam
Park Regeneration Joint Venture LLP Overarching Business Plan
2019-20, full details of which are contained within the Exempt Agenda Report.
-
Agreed
that the Leader of the Council
and Cabinet Member for Housing after consultation with the s151
Officer, the Chief Executive Officer and the Director of Legal and
Governance, approve the finalised Overarching Business Plan
2019-20, and possible later incorporation of an additional site
known as the ‘Rainham Opportunity
Site’ as may be presented
during the Business Plan 2019-20 period.
-
Agreed to Endorse and
Recommend to Council the budget
allocation set out in this report to include the related site known
as ‘Rainham Opportunity Site’ with the Rainham and Beam
Park Regeneration Scheme.
-
Agreed
that the s151 Officer, after
consultation with the Cabinet Member for Housing, responds to the
service of any notice as described in Section 8.4 of this report,
served by the Rainham and Beam Park Regeneration Joint Venture LLP,
indicating a willingness or otherwise to participate in making
third party debt available from the Council, subject to contract
and due diligence.
-
Agreed
that the s151 Officer, after
consultation with the Chief Executive and The Leader of the
Council, may enter into funding agreements consistent with the
Treasury Management Strategy and Council’s Scheme of
Delegation.
-
Agreed the
revised capital profile which brings forward £1.5m capital
expenditure from 2019/20 to 2018/19.
